Defaults are listed in `modules/module/settings/cats.nix`. ```nix projectSettings = { cats = { python = true; # enable Python tooling r = false; # disable R nix = true; lua = false; markdown = false; optional = false; gitPlugins = false; }; }; ``` ### Language packages (module defaults) Add Python/R/Julia libraries that get appended to the module defaults. The built-in defaults are: - Python: `duckdb`, `polars` - R: `arrow`, `broom`, `data_table`, `janitor`, `styler` - Julia: `DataFramesMeta`, `QuackIO` ```nix projectSettings = { settings.lang_packages = { python = with pkgs.python3Packages; [ pandas numpy ]; r = with pkgs.rpkgs.rPackages; [ fixest data_table ]; julia = [ "StatsBase" "Plots" ]; }; }; ``` Use `lib.mkForce` to replace rather than append: ```nix projectSettings = { settings.lang_packages = { python = pkgs.lib.mkForce (with pkgs.python3Packages; [ polars duckdb ]); }; }; ``` ### Runtime dependencies (per-cat packages) Override `catPkgs` to change the full runtime tool lists that appear in both the wrapper PATH and the devShell. Use normal assignments to merge list values, or `lib.mkForce` to replace them. ```nix projectSettings = { catPkgs = { nix = [ pkgs.nil pkgs.nixfmt ]; python = [ (pkgs.python3.withPackages (ps: [ ps.pandas ps.duckdb ])) pkgs.ruff ]; }; }; ``` ### Direct runtimePkgs override (always-on) Add packages to `catPkgs.always` for tools that should always be available regardless of other cat toggles. ```nix projectSettings = { catPkgs = { always = [ pkgs.git pkgs.curl pkgs.pre-commit ]; }; }; ``` ### Runtime env vars ```nix projectSettings = { env = { MY_PROJECT_VAR = "some-value"; }; envDefault = { EDITOR = "vv"; }; }; ``` `env` values are forced; `envDefault` values can be overridden by the user's shell. ### Choosing the right override surface - Use `cats` to enable or disable a whole language or tooling category. - Use `settings.lang_packages` to add or replace Python, R, or Julia libraries within a language environment. - Use `catPkgs` to change the full runtime tool list for a category. `config.runtimePkgs` drives wrapper PATH composition, while `nvimConfig.lib.devShellPackages config` returns the package-only list suitable for `mkShell`. - Use `env` or `envDefault` for wrapper environment variables. - Use `specs` for plugin additions or custom runtime behavior. ### Neovim settings ```nix projectSettings = { settings = { colorscheme = "kanagawa"; background = "dark"; wrapRc = true; config_directory = ./nvim; # path to init.lua + lua/ dir aliases = [ "v" "nvim" ]; # extra binary names (default: [ "vvim" ]) }; binName = "nv"; # binary name (default: vv) }; ``` ## Adding plugins ```nix projectSettings = { specs = { extraPlugins = { data = with pkgs.vimPlugins; [ telescope-nvim which-key-nvim ]; }; extraLazy = { lazy = true; data = with pkgs.vimPlugins; [ dashboard-nvim ]; }; # Inject Lua config at startup extraLua = { data = pkgs.writeText "extra.lua" '' vim.opt.number = true vim.opt.relativenumber = true ''; before = ["INIT_MAIN"]; }; }; }; ``` ## Architecture ``` settings/lang-packages.nix ──► settings.lang_packages │ cats.nix ───────────────► config.cats │ │ │ ▼ ▼ cat-packages.nix ───────► config.catPkgs. │ │ ├──────────────┐ │ ▼ ▼ ▼ deps.nix PATH wrapper.config.wrap devShells.default ``` - **Overlays** (`overlays/`) inject dependency package sets into nixpkgs (`rpkgs`, `baseRPackages`, `basePythonPackages`, plugins). Top-level `rWrapper` and `quarto` are compatibility conveniences, but `pkgs.rpkgs` is the canonical R surface for downstream configuration. - **cat-packages.nix** is the single source of truth for per-category packages. Each list is gated by its cat toggle. - **deps.nix** wires `catPkgs` into the wrapper's runtime PATH. - **settings.lang_packages** holds the shared defaults used by local outputs and downstream module consumers. - **flake.nix** exports `lib.eval`, `lib.mkWrapper`, `lib.devShellPackages`, and `lib.shellHook` as the canonical downstream helpers, and builds `packages.default` and `devShells.default` from the same module config.
